LEGEND
Lock-release function: can be used to activate the lock-release relay
Privacy function: can be used to enable or to disable the ringtone for calls from the external unit and paging.
Audio key function: can be used to activate a conversation with the external unit or to end a conversation.
Generic actuator function: can be used to activate the relay for a generic actuator installed within the system.
ACT
Coded actuator function: can be used to activate the relay for a specific actuator installed within the system.
Self-ignition function: can be used to receive images from the main external unit cameras (press the key again to cycle through several
AI
external unit)
D
Doctor function: can be used to enable automatic activation of the lock-release in response to a call from the external unit.
Internal intercom function: can be used to make a call to the internal units with the same user code.
INT
General intercom to another user code: can be used to make a call to the internal units with another user code.
Internal paging function: can be used to make a paging call to the internal units with the same user code.
PAG
General paging to another user code: can be used to make a paging call to the internal units with another user code.
NULL
No function
